The global genetic testing market is experiencing significant growth, driven by technological advancements, increasing awareness, and the rising prevalence of genetic disorders. Here's an overview of the market, including recent developments, key drivers and restraints, regional insights, emerging trends, top use cases, major challenges, and attractive opportunities:
📈 Recent Developments
-
Market Growth: The global genetic testing market was valued at USD 17.4 billion in 2022, growing at a CAGR of 9.8% from 2023 to 2032. The market is expected to reach USD 44.3 billion by 2032.
-
Acquisitions: In March 2024, Illumina Inc. announced its acquisition of Grail Inc., a leader in multi-cancer early detection tests, aiming to enhance its capabilities in comprehensive cancer screening solutions.
-
Product Launches: In November 2023, Myriad Genetics launched its new BRACAnalysis CDx test for assessing the risk of breast cancer, integrating advanced genomic technology for more accurate risk assessments and personalized treatment options.
🚀 Market Drivers
-
Rising Prevalence of Genetic Disorders: The increasing incidence of genetic disorders and cancers globally is a significant driver for the genetic testing market.
-
Advancements in Genomic Technologies: Continuous advancements in genomic technologies, such as next-generation sequencing (NGS), have significantly reduced the cost and time required for genetic testing, making it more accessible.
-
Growing Demand for Personalized Medicine: The shift towards personalized medicine, where treatments are tailored to individual genetic profiles, is propelling the demand for genetic testing.
🛑 Market Restraints
-
High Costs of Advanced Testing: Despite technological advancements, the cost of comprehensive genetic tests remains high, limiting access, especially in developing regions.
-
Lack of Regulatory Standardization: The absence of standardized regulations across different regions leads to inconsistencies in test quality and interpretation, affecting reliability.
-
Limited Infrastructure in Developing Countries: Inadequate healthcare infrastructure and a shortage of trained professionals in developing countries hinder the adoption of genetic testing.
🌍 Regional Segmentation Analysis
-
North America: Dominated the market with a 46.3% share in 2023, attributed to advanced genetic testing technologies, a high prevalence of genetic disorders, and favorable reimbursement policies.
-
Asia Pacific: Expected to register the highest CAGR during the forecast period, driven by a vast geriatric population, increasing prevalence of genetic diseases, and growing awareness of genetic testing.
-
India: In December 2023, Progenesis, a prominent genetic testing brand, entered the Indian market by inaugurating its first genetic laboratory in New Delhi and an AI & Bioinformatics Data Centre in Chennai, signaling significant expansion into the dynamic Asia-Pacific market.
🌟 Emerging Trends
-
Direct-to-Consumer (DTC) Genetic Testing: There's a growing demand for DTC genetic testing services, allowing consumers to access information about their genetic predispositions without medical intermediaries.
-
Integration with Electronic Health Records (EHRs): Efforts are underway to integrate genetic data into EHRs, facilitating personalized treatment plans and improving patient care.
-
Use of Artificial Intelligence (AI): AI is being leveraged to analyze complex genetic data, enhancing the accuracy and efficiency of genetic testing.
💼 Top Use Cases
-
Cancer Risk Assessment: Genetic testing is used to identify mutations associated with increased cancer risk, enabling early intervention and personalized treatment strategies.
-
Prenatal and Newborn Screening: Early detection of genetic disorders in fetuses and newborns allows for timely medical interventions.
-
Carrier Testing: Identifies individuals who carry a gene for a recessive genetic disorder, aiding in family planning decisions.
-
Pharmacogenomics: Analyzes how genes affect a person's response to drugs, facilitating personalized medication plans.
⚠️ Major Challenges
-
Interpretation of Complex Data: The complexity of genetic information requires specialized knowledge for accurate interpretation, posing challenges for healthcare providers.
-
Ethical and Privacy Concerns: The handling of sensitive genetic data raises ethical issues and concerns about data privacy and potential misuse.
-
Inconclusive or Uncertain Results: Genetic tests can sometimes yield ambiguous results, leading to anxiety and uncertainty for patients.
